What is Scutellaria laetviolaceae
Scutellaria laetviolaceae (scientific name: Scutellaria laetviolaceae) is a perennial herb native to Japan and China, belonging to the Scutellaria genus of the Lamiaceae family. It grows wild in slightly moist forests in Honshu, Shikoku, and Kyushu in Japan. It is a member of the Scutellaria family, and its leaves are ovate-triangular and veined like those of the Perilla frutescens.
Common name: Scutellaria laetviolaceae, scientific name: Scutellaria laetviolaceae, plant kingdom: Japan, China, height: 5-15 cm, leaf shape: egg-shaped triangle, inflorescence: opposite, leaf length: 1.5-4 cm, inflorescence length: 4-6 cm, flower length: 2 cm, flower color: blue-purple, flower shape: lip-shaped, flowering season: May to June.
